#97006f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#97006f is composed of 59.2% red, 0%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 26.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29.6%. #97006f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00de with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#97006f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#97006f has RGB values of R:151, G:0,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.26,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9896047.

Shades and Tints of #97006f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000a is the darkest color, while #fff9fd is the lightest one.
